Output 34ca2adfbd2ad3d7fc640ef9937529ef9dac0ed535874cd525fb6053946e1773:3

value
104151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28fd4bc65eae497d5fe3ef89a45756545f5f9308 OP_EQUAL
address
MBdthRBTUe3VjTUuywLhQdK6Yuu5k4xHWM
transaction
34ca2adfbd2ad3d7fc640ef9937529ef9dac0ed535874cd525fb6053946e1773
spent
true